Is 1,737,900 mAh allowed on a plane?
At 3.7V, 1,737,900 mAh = 6,430.23 Wh. Airlines allow lithium batteries up to 100 Wh in carry-on luggage. Batteries between 100–160 Wh require airline approval. Batteries over 160 Wh are prohibited on passenger aircraft.
